Straparella placidus

Gastropoda - Turbinidae

Taxonomy
Straparollus placidus was named by de Koninck (1881). It is a 3D body fossil.

It was recombined as Straparollus (Straparollus) placidus by Gromczakiewicz (1967) and Gromczakiewicz-Łomnicka (1973); it was recombined as Straparella placidus by Wagner (2023).
